Due to inclement weather expected in the Los Angeles area this weekend, Friday's game has been changed to a doubleheader beginning at 2:00 p.m. PT.
SALT LAKE CITY - The Utah baseball team plays its first Pac-12 game this weekend in Los Angeles at USC, beginning on Friday, March 16, at 6:00 p.m. PT.
Utah went 2-2 last weekend at the Jack Gifford Memorial Tournament, defeating Lehigh and Columbia. The Utes had solid outings against Santa Clara and San Jose State, despite the losses.
USC is ranked 27th in the NCBWA Poll with a 12-3 record. The Trojans are coming off a three-game sweep of CSU Bakersfield, and have won their last five games.
"I think all of our sports have felt this way, but the first chance to play in the Pac-12 is special," Utah head coach Bill Kinneberg said. "We're playing a very good team in USC with great players and a great tradition. We've got our hands full. We just need to try to get better every day, and we hope to go down and play well this weekend."
Utah's Joe Pond will face USC's Andrew Triggs in game one of the series.
